Hi all — quick note from the front desk at Quillard & Moss. Over the holiday period (23rd to 2nd) the building opens at 10 and closes at 4, so plan around that. The main doors stay locked outside those hours. New starters: if you need access on those days, use the side entrance on Ferris Lane and enter the code below.

door code, kawip-bagap: bdg-HQEWH-4

Handover — Quillbase ORM refactor

Mira, handing this to you cleanly: the legacy ORM layer in Quillbase still signs its migration manifests with the old scheme, so the security review must cover both signing paths until phase two lands. All write-path adapters are now behind the shim. To unlock the migration vault and audit the manifests, you'll need the recovery passphrase, which follows below.

vault phrase of tajeg-tageg = pelix-druix-holius-briael-zorwyn-frawyn-fraox-norok-drueth-aldiel

## Authentication

The Restockr planner talks to the internal Cartwheel inventory service over HTTPS. All requests must carry a key in the `X-Cartwheel-Auth` header; unauthenticated calls are rejected with a 401 and are not retried. Please store the key in your local env file, never in source. Use the following key for staging access.

app token of bahaf-tajeg = zpat23_SjjsllwiLmXbtS65veZaV47